Performance Analysis and Modeling of an Indoor IoT-Oriented Energy Harvesting Optical Wireless Sensor Network

Abstract

Wireless sensor networks (WSNs) are poised to play a pivotal role in enabling smart indoor environments as part of the evolution from the Internet of Things to the Internet of Everything in 6G systems. However, this transition faces critical challenges, notably radio frequency (RF) spectrum congestion and the limited lifespan of battery-powered sensor nodes. To address these issues, this paper proposes a novel hybrid network architecture that integrates Optical wireless communication with energy harvesting capabilities. Since WSNs typically require low data rates, the system leverages photovoltaic technology to function dually as optical photodetectors and energy harvesters. We model performance aspects of the proposed system, including signal-to-noise ratio, power consumption, and the amount of energy that can be harvested in a typical indoor environment. This approach not only alleviates RF spectrum congestion but also significantly extends the operational lifetime of sensor nodes, offering a sustainable solution for next-generation smart environments.
